Subject: Keyspinner cut-over complete

Team — the migration of our secrets-rotation utility, Keyspinner, from the legacy Harrowmill scheduler to the new Bramblewick orchestrator finished Tuesday at 02:40 local. All 312 managed credentials rotated cleanly on the first post-cut-over cycle; two stale leases in the Oxbarn vault were revoked manually and documented in the change log. No consumer services reported auth failures. For reference at the sync, the active configuration is listed below.

config for hahip-kaguf:
[holath]
port = 8443
region = north-4
host = holath.tolvaqlabs.internal
timeout_ms = 1000
retries = 2

[ ] Step 6 of the Larkmoor key ceremony: re-key the sampling config for ChatterRelay. Plugin authors, note that once the new signing key is live, your plugins must fetch the updated log-sampling manifest or the service will drop to the 1% default rate and your debug traces will mostly vanish. The manifest archive is sealed until the ceremony completes. When the quorum signs off, unseal it by entering the recovery passphrase printed here:

unlock words, fahog-yahof: belael-holael-eliius-joreth-tamax-olimir-norwyn-holwyn-fraath-lamius-norwyn-druys-soriel

Ticket #—: Config drift on Slabdiff workers

Support folks, quick one. The Slabdiff large-file diff viewer is behaving differently across the worker pool — some nodes chunk at 64MB, others at the old 16MB, so customers see inconsistent rendering on huge files. Looks like a half-rolled config push from the Marwick deploy two weeks ago. Please don't hand-edit nodes; we'll reconverge via the manager. For reference while triaging, the intended canonical values are as follows.

config for fawif-tajop:
wenath:
  pin: 8088
  tenant: gorwyn
  seal: seal_41405b34
  metrics_host: metrics.wenath.nelvrosys.corp
  standby_team: wenael
  escalation: ulaix-kelath
  nonce: 5d2add